The most recent mileage data for the Peugeot 508 (2011-15) shows a diverse distribution, with the highest proportion of vehicles (14.3%) recorded between 110,000 and 120,000 miles. Notably, a significant number of vehicles (11.1%) have mileage between 120,000 and 130,000 miles, and smaller but notable percentages are found in the higher ranges above 150,000 miles. Conversely, vehicles with very low mileage (under 10,000 miles) account for only 4.8%. There are also few vehicles recorded with extremely high mileage beyond 200,000 miles, representing a small percentage (around 1.6%). Overall, the data suggests that a considerable portion of these vehicles accumulate mileage in the 110,000 to 140,000 mile range, with fewer vehicles at the very low or very high ends of the mileage spectrum.

The private sale valuation data for the Peugeot 508 (2011-15) 4-door saloon with a 2.0 HDI DPF 140 EU5 SR 6SPD indicates that the majority of vehicles are estimated to sell for between £3,000 and £4,000, accounting for 34.9% of valuations. Notably, a significant portion—approximately 22.2%—are valued between £1,000 and £2,000, suggesting a healthy spread across lower price ranges. Combined, the data shows that nearly 80% of private sale valuations fall below the £4,000 mark, reflecting the vehicle’s positioning in the used car market as an affordable option. Only a small percentage (around 1.6%) are valued above £6,000, indicating limited higher-end private sale prices for this model within the sample.

The data indicates that among the sample of Peugeot 508 models (2011-15 4-door saloons with a 2.0 HDI DPF 140 EU5 SR 6SPD), black is the most common main paint colour, accounting for 33.3% of vehicles. White also features prominently at 23.8%. The remaining vehicles are fairly evenly distributed among grey, silver, and blue, each representing 14.3%. This suggests a preference for darker, classic colours like black and white within this model range, while other colours are used more modestly.

The data on the number of registered keepers for the PEUGEOT 508 (2011–15) 4DR SALOON 2.0 HDI DPF 140 EU5 SR 6SPD indicates a relatively diverse ownership history. Notably, the largest groups are vehicles with 5 and 3 registered keepers, each accounting for 22.2% of the sample, suggesting that these cars often change hands multiple times but tend to stay with a vehicle owner for a few periods. Smaller numbers of vehicles have only 1 or 2 keepers, representing 4.8% and 15.9% respectively, which may imply some cars remain with the original owner longer or change hands less frequently. Interestingly, only a small fraction (1.6%) have 9 registered keepers, indicating that very high turnover in ownership is relatively uncommon. Overall, the data suggests a pattern of moderate to high ownership changes, with no clearly dominant number of keepers per vehicle.
